TMC2209 is a perfect alternative to upgrade the stepper motor driver of 3D printer. It is compatible with existing 3D printer electronics and can easily replace the TMC2208, A4988, and other stepper motor drivers. With its advanced functions such as silent operation, precise micro-stepping, and sensorless homing, it can significantly improve the performance of your 3D printer.
The driver default current is 1.25A, with a maximum current of 2.5A, continuous and stable printing current can reach 1.8A, logic voltage of 3.3V / 5V, and input voltage of 5.5V - 28V. The micro-stepping capability can go up to 1/256, providing precise control over movement of the stepper motor.
Adopting a noise free and high-precision chopping algorithm, the motor will not produce any sound during both motion and rest, making it very quiet during the printing process.
The TMC2209 silent stepper driver is designed to have excellent heat dissipation and generate low heat. It has a large cooling area that helps to keep the temperature low even when working for extended periods of time. Compared to other stepper motor drivers, the TMC2209 can lower the heat generated by up to 30 percent.
Perfect fit for MKS SGEN-L, supports UART mode, supports infinite bit return to zero, and is set through jumper caps.
